选择的语句(选择结构语句)
选择语句在编程中扮演着重要的角色。选择语句是程序中的一种流程控制语句,用于根据条件选择要执行的代码块。选择结构语句通常包括三个关键字:if、else、else if。
if语句
if语句是最简单的选择结构语句。它的语法结构如下:
if(条件) { 执行代码块;
}
条件是一个布尔表达式,如果条件为真,则执行代码块中的语句,否则不执行。
if…else语句
if…else语句是选择结构语句中最常用的语句。它的语法结构如下:
if(条件) { 执行代码块;
}
else {
执行代码块;
}
如果条件为真,则执行if代码块中的语句,否则执行else代码块中的语句。if和else块中可以放置任意数量的语句,包括其他的if…else语句。
else if语句
else if语句是在if…else中进一步连接多个条件语句的方法。它的语法结构如下:
if(条件1) { 执行代码块;
}
else if(条件2){
执行代码块;
}
else {
执行代码块;
}
如果条件1为真,则执行if代码块中的语句。如果条件2为真,则执行else if代码块中的语句。如果条件1和条件2都为假,则执行else代码块中的语句。
多重选择语句-switch…case
switch…case是一种多重选择语句,它可以基于一个变量的值,从多个选项中选择一个要执行的代码块。它的语法结构如下:
switch(变量) { case 值1:
执行代码块1;
break;
case 值2:
执行代码块2;
break;
case 值3:
执行代码块3;
break;
default:
执行代码块;
}
变量是要测试的变量。值1、值2和值3是可选的,它们与变量进行比较。如果变量等于某个值,则执行相应的代码块。如果没有匹配的值,则执行default代码块。
最后的总结
选择语句是程序中最常见的语句之一。if、else、else if和switch…case语句都是选择结构语句,用于根据条件选择要执行的代码块。编程中合适的选择语句可以让程序更加灵活、可读性更高、功能更加完善。